自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(4)
  • 收藏
  • 关注

原创 HDU 1257 贪心

题意: http://acm.hdu.edu.cn/showproblem.php?pid=1257 思路: 原来的思路为了让一个拦截系统拦截尽可能多的导弹,我就让后面只要顺序小于这个数的导弹都归他拦截(就是依次剔除递减序列,但其实并没有达到让每个拦截系统拦截尽可能多的导弹的作用)所以以后有了贪心思路多想几组数据。。而且从面对的最普通情况进行分析(多个拦截系统,选择让一个拦截系统去拦截,

2017-05-31 10:41:58 307

原创 [带权并查集] 学习一个

(生活有点小烦,希望在写代码的时候能够纯粹一点。) 先作一点铺垫: 从以前的认识来看,并查集(Union-Find Sets)可以实现分类的目的。 她提供两种操作:1.Find-查询根节点   2.Union-合并(两个元素间的关系将两个不同集合合并为一个,保证了关系的传递性) 值得注意的是并查集有两个优化的方法—— 1. 为了防止退化成链,合并两个集合时,将高度小的的树接在高度高的树上

2017-05-24 19:23:57 275

原创 Codeforces 782B 二分搜索

题意: x正半轴上的n个人,知道每个人的初始位置(x)和最大速度(v)。 求所有人相聚到一起的最短时间 找到一个使所有人全速移动且同时汇聚的点 (想到这个转化才想到用二分,证明嘛我还没想好,求助一波回头更新) 思路: 第一次做完全没有思路...... 违背信仰看了网上的代码,是二分搜索找到上文所说的点(其实只要精度达到就可以),用lt,rt记录mid两边的点到达中间点需要的时间

2017-05-13 02:10:07 276

原创 Uva725 Division

题意: 每组测试数据输入一个值n,对于每一个测试数据: 你要从0~9中取数给abcde和fghij每个字母赋值(每个数字用且只能用一次),形成两个数abcde和fghij,如果满足abcde / fghij = n,则按格式 xxxxx /xxxxx = n 输出所有可能情况(前导0允许存在而且需要输出);如果没有满足条件的情况则输出相应语句; 思路: 【两眼一闭写暴力】 穷举所

2017-04-25 02:59:58 365

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除